How it All Came Around.
It all started with Hanneke. She said:
"When I began preparing for my show, GROWTH!, for this year's World Cup, I knew I did not want it to be just another floral performance. For me, GROWTH! was never only about design. It was about people. About the future of our craft. About giving young floral talents a stage where they could learn, create, and shine. I have always believed deeply in education and craftsmanship because they are the roots that keep our industry alive and evolving. That is why I decided to involve seven young floral designers in the preparation of the show, giving each of them the space to create a personal piece inspired by their own vision."
And I was one of those...
My Bridal Bouquet
I designed a large bridal bouquet, constructed from layers of soft tissue treated with candle wax to create subtle texture and volume. At its core, I used a bridal bouquet holder from OASIS Floral Products Benelux, surrounded by a stunning mix of Anthura varieties, including rare Anthuriums and Phalaenopsis orchids, some sourced directly from Anthura’s botanical garden. The final design stood in a graceful vase from Jodeco Glass, completing the harmony of craftsmanship, my creativity, and signature style.
